David Leroy Anderson was the Department Head for this show, responsible for the character design and fabrication through his company AFX Studios, as well as the on set work. Brian was hired by David to be a part of the on set team, mostly helping Scott Wheeler with his character of “Mr. Tall”, played by Ken Watanbe.

“Mr. Tall’s” character consisted of a foam latex head piece, finger extension and a wig. I assisted Scott Wheeler with this makeup, whilst shooting in New Orleans.

main upload.jpg